Galldris Group is seeking a full-time Class 2 Tipper Driver for their Sizewell C site. The role involves transporting goods and raw materials, conducting vehicle checks, and performing maintenance. Candidates should have LGV experience and be eligible to work legally in the UK. The working hours are from 6:30 am to 4:30 pm, Monday to Friday, with occasional extra hours required. Galldris Group is an Equal Opportunities employer.
